Export Prices in Georgia increased to 99.40 points in July from 97.60 points in June of 2026. Export Prices in Georgia averaged 100.65 points from 2014 until 2026, reaching an all time high of 111.80 points in December of 2016 and a record low of 93.80 points in July of 2022. source: National Statistics Office of Georgia
